PixMeat is a local portrait retouching desktop app built with Electron, React, TypeScript, and a Python image-processing engine. Images stay on the local machine; the Electron UI talks to the Python engine over stdio JSON-RPC and passes image file paths instead of image bytes.
- Node.js 20+
- pnpm 9+
- macOS or Windows for the desktop app
Python 3.11 or 3.12 is useful for engine development, but it is no longer required just to run pnpm dev or a packaged app. PixMeat can generate a bundled uv/Python runtime under engine/runtime.

python -m pytestIn development the Electron main process automatically uses engine/.venv when it exists. If it does not exist, pnpm dev runs scripts/prepare-engine-runtime.mjs --if-missing, which injects uv/Python with tiny-runtime-injector and installs engine/requirements.txt into engine/runtime/venv.

.venv/bin/python -m beauty_engine.cli analyze ../demo/before.jpg /tmp/pixmeat-analysis --analysis-version v2Analysis V2 is the default analysis path and is still configurable through engine config and environment variables. It adds model-backed slots for face detection, landmarks, person segmentation, human parsing, semantic skin masks, body regions, and debug overlays. Missing model paths never trigger network downloads; the engine records diagnostics and degrades to deterministic CPU geometry. Legacy skin/background face guesses are disabled by default.

pnpm distpnpm dist runs pnpm engine:runtime first. Packaged builds include the Python engine source, local models, the injected uv/Python runtime, and the installed Python dependencies. If a standalone engine/dist/beauty-engine binary is present, Electron still prefers that binary.
